AC Milan vs. Cremonese: Key facts and stats
➤ This will be the 17th Serie A meeting between AC Milan and Cremonese, with the head-to-head record favouring the Rossoneri (ten wins to two). There have been four draws, including the two most recent encounters in the 2022/23 season. It will also be the first time these two teams have faced each other on the opening weekend.

➤ AC Milan have won four of their last five opening-day Serie A matches – the only exception being their 2-2 draw with Torino last season – while Cremonese have lost all eight of their previous season openers, all away from home.
➤ Last season, AC Milan were the team to earn the most points from losing positions in Serie A (22), while Cremonese were third in this regard in Serie B (14, behind Spezia and Catanzaro on 17 each).
➤ In 2024/25, the Rossoneri scored 95% of their goals from inside the box, while the Grigiorossi attempted more shots than any other team in Serie B.
➤ Luka Modrić is currently the only Ballon d’Or winner playing in Serie A. The Croatian champion comes off a season in which he set a personal record for appearances with Real Madrid (57) and contributed to 13 goals, scoring four and providing nine assists.
